Job summary

The State of Maryland seeks a Chief Operating Officer for the Developmental Disabilities Administration in Baltimore to provide strategic leadership and oversight of statewide program operations for individuals with IDD. The COO will guide the Community Pathways waiver program and related services, ensuring compliance, fiscal stewardship, and mission-aligned outcomes.

The role requires collaboration with the Governor's Office, MDH, and community partners to drive organizational transformation,

Qualifications

  • Bachelor's degree in Accounting or related field with 30 credit hours in accounting and related courses, including auditing.
  • Five years of progressive experience in financial management, accounting, expenditure management or business administration.
  • Experience in leading cross-functional teams and implementing complex programs.

Responsibilities

  • Provide strategic leadership, direction, and oversight for statewide program operations supporting individuals with intellectual and developmental disabilities.
  • Direct development, implementation, monitoring, and continuous improvement of the Community Pathways waiver program and Title VII State-funded services.
  • Lead organizational initiatives to improve performance, streamline processes, and strengthen accountability while coordinating with MDH and other agencies.
  • Represent the Administration to policymakers, advocates, and partners to advance mission and strategic goals.
